Which Type of Patient Bed Is Best for Different Situations?
Patient beds are available in several designs, each serving a different purpose. Manual hospital beds use hand-operated mechanisms and are often suitable when basic positioning adjustments are required. Semi-electric models provide powered adjustment for certain functions while retaining manual controls for others. Fully electric beds offer greater convenience because users can adjust different sections using a control system. Home-care beds may also feature compact designs that fit more easily into bedrooms while providing essential support for patients and caregivers.
Why Do Adjustable Features Matter So Much?
Adjustability is one of the most valuable features to consider when selecting a patient bed. Raising or lowering the back section can help patients find a more comfortable position for sleeping, eating, reading, or receiving care. Leg adjustments can provide additional support and may improve positioning during extended periods of bed rest. Height adjustment can also make it easier for caregivers to assist patients safely. Although beds with more adjustment options may cost more, their additional functionality can provide meaningful long-term value.
What Safety Features Should Buyers Look For?
Safety should never be overlooked when comparing patient beds. Strong side rails can help reduce the risk of accidental falls, particularly for patients with limited mobility. Lockable wheels keep the bed stable when it is positioned for treatment or rest. A sturdy frame provides reliable support, while smooth adjustment mechanisms reduce unnecessary movement during repositioning. Buyers should also consider whether emergency lowering, secure controls, and suitable weight capacity are appropriate for the patient's needs. These features contribute to a safer care environment.
How Does Material Quality Affect the Overall Cost?
The materials used to manufacture a patient bed have a direct influence on durability and performance. Strong metal frames are generally preferred because they can withstand frequent use and support substantial loads. High-quality finishes may provide greater resistance against corrosion, scratches, and everyday wear. The quality of joints, wheels, adjustment mechanisms, and side rails also matters because these components are repeatedly used by patients and caregivers. A durable bed may have a higher initial cost but can offer better value over an extended period.
Is a Patient Bed Worth Buying for Home Care?
Home-based patient care has become increasingly common, particularly when patients require extended recovery or assistance with mobility. Using an appropriate patient bed at home can make everyday caregiving easier by providing better positioning and access. Adjustable sections can help patients sit up without relying entirely on another person, while wheels allow caregivers to reposition the bed when necessary. Before purchasing, families should measure the available room and consider doorway width, electrical requirements, mattress compatibility, and ease of maintenance.
